About SEPA
The Smart Electric Power Alliance (SEPA), a 501(c)(3) organization with over 1,000 members, accelerates the transition to a clean, affordable, and resilient electricity system for all. SEPA engages with its diverse membership -- including utilities, policymakers, regulators, and technology companies -- through education, collaboration and convening to advance innovative policy, regulatory, and technology solutions. About the Opportunity
The Manager, Payroll & Benefits is responsible for the accurate and timely processing of payroll for our fully remote, multi-state workforce and serves as the primary point of contact for employee benefits enrollment, life events, and leave administration. You will ensure compliance with payroll and benefits regulations, maintain data integrity within our UKG HRIS system, and support a positive employee experience through responsive and knowledgeable service. This position also manages payroll tax reporting, benefit plan deductions, and year-end processing in coordination with our Finance and third-party vendors.
The Manager reports to the Chief People and Culture Officer and works closely with the People & Culture team. Also partners with the Finance department, and external vendors to support a seamless and compliant employee experience.
